Assassins Creed Odyssey
Alright so this one is a bit of a struggle for me to decide on. While I love the setting and the idea of Spartans and such (Ancient Greece looks beautiful) the gameplay shows this as being quite the same as Origins, the last game. It just seems like a reskin, and there doesn't seem to be that much... Assassin stuff. I do like the RPG aspects welcomed into this one though, and the choice of characters and romancing, but I'm not sure if that'll be enough to keep me interested. I'll keep my eyes on this one.


Forza Horizon 4
So I've never been a big player of the Horizon games, but from what I have played of them, they've been viciously fun. The worlds are always interesting, and the forth instalment looks just as being set in... England. Yes! The trailer showed off some beautiful looking countryside and English villages, as well as some fun looking cars that tie the world together. Count me in.


Spider-Man
It's almost here! The game has already had so much revealed about it considering it's out in September, but some nice new gameplay footage was shown at Sony's conference with the reveal of some classic Spider-Man villains including an amazingly designed Electro. While it does look very Batman: Arkham Asylum, it still looks as though it's going to be a very unique and exciting set-up for a new franchise of Spidey games.



Fallout 76
When this was announced a couple of weeks ago, I was buzzing, being such a massive fan of the Fallout series. Then, when Bethesda brought this to E3, I was even more buzzing. With a map 4x the size of that in Fallout 4, set in West Virginia - what more could be as exciting? The multiplayer was confirmed and my excitement... it wore off a little. Unfortunately we won't have NPC's in this large sprawling world and that really annoys me. I don't mind multiplayer but a single player option would be nice, I don't want always online, that sucks! Needless to say I'll still play this game, but I hope that it may change my mind for the good before it's November release.


Cyberpunk 2077
Holy mother of god. This game looks stunning. From the developers of The Witcher 3, widely considered as one of the best RPG's out there, Cyberpunk 2077 will be a futuristic Sci-Fi RPG, being a first-person shooter too. While details are still scarce this looks like every Blade Runner maniac's dream (me) and I can't wait to see more of it in the future.
